Overview

The Senior Financial Operations Analyst, Finance is responsible for High Five’s financial planning and analysis function and provides analytical support to practice operations. The successful candidate will evaluate practice operating and financial performance to identify opportunities and risks; further working with the practice operating leaders to optimize the operations with a focus on best-in-class patient care and margin expansion. While serving as a key business partner to practice operations in this capacity, the analyst will develop budgets and forecasts, utilizing key operating and financial metrics and business trends to develop short-term and long-term plans.

A keen owner of the company’s financial data, the analyst will track the health and profitability of the business, confidently advising executive leadership and other stakeholders using standard and ad-hoc analysis tools to make thoughtful decisions to steer the business. You will be a trusted resource to measure return of key strategic initiatives, coordinate future capital planning, and contribute to the preparation of executive presentations used in conversations with the Board, third-party investors, and analysts.

Responsibilities
  • Serve as the subject matter expert over the practice operating and financial reporting and forecast planning solutions, identifying process enhancements resulting in time efficient and measurable benefits for the practices.
  • Drive the budget variance analysis (“BVA”) process and present findings to the practice leadership and executive leadership.
  • Develop and consolidate annual budget/forecast models in partnership with operational leaders based on recent trends, expectations, and predictive models that assess the viability of new initiatives or projects that will benefit the business.
  • Analyze financial reports and key business indicators utilizing requisite reporting systems. Identify trends, anomalies, and discrepancies that require management attention.
  • Partnering with the operations support team evaluate and model operating process improvements, including cost/benefit analysis of those operating changes in various scenarios.
  • Develop presentations and reports that accurately reflect the state of practice performance, opportunities, and risks to internal and external stakeholders.
  • Utilize analytical tools to analyze large data sets to aid in budgeting and forecasting automation.
  • Support the inputs to the annual capital planning cycle, including the development of cash flow and cost benefit models to adequately calculate ROI and payback on strategy investments.
  • Partner with practice and corporate leaders by serving as a trusted advisor; providing insights and measurable data to improve operating results.
Qualifications
  • 3 or more years of experience in financial reporting and analytics.
  • Bachelor’s degree from a four-year college or university, preferably in accounting or finance. CPA, CFA, and/or MBA a plus.
  • Thorough understanding of financial modeling concepts with a focus on cash flow modeling and end-use financial metrics (i.e. – ROI, IRR, NPV, etc).
  • Excellent planning, observation, communication and presentation skills.
  • Ability to problem solve and think analytically.
  • Proficient with the Microsoft Office suite, including Excel, Word, and Outlook.
  • Experience with financial systems such as Sage Intacct, Adaptive Solutions, SQL, Alteryx, Power Bi, and/or Tableau is desirable.
  • Ability to prioritize and work independently but also be collaborative with others.
  • Must be able to multi-task and be detail oriented.
  • Enjoys a fast-paced work environment.
